PlayStation Keeps Failing at Live-Service

PlayStation can’t seem to get out of its own way with its monster push of live-service games over the past five years or so. It’s pushed its first-party studios that were built on single-player games to pivot to live-service. And the results speak for themselves. Well over a dozen failed games (most of which never saw the light of day), including Concord and games in the God of War, Twisted Metal, and The Last of Us franchises. They also have a whole debacle going on at Bungie where one of those live-service games was canceled, Destiny 2 development ended after an up-and-down nine-year run, and Marathon released to collective groans both from people not enjoying the game and those who felt squeamish at the controversy of the game containing plagiarized work.

This week, another game was added to this list of failures: Horizon Hunters Gathering. An upcoming co-op action game set in PlayStation’s Horizon series, Horizon Hunters Gathering was meant to be yet another attempt at a live-service game to unlock infinite money for Sony. And it is now yet another failed attempt at that. This week, it was revealed that due to poor player feedback, developer Guerrilla Games has spent the past couple of months ripping out all of the live-service content.

Through PlayStation’s live-service experimentation, the only one that has seen any sort of noticeable success outside of its already-existing MLB: The Show franchise is Helldivers II, a game where PlayStation only acted in a publishing capacity since it was developed by a third-party studio.

I think it’s pretty easy to see in retrospect why the PlayStation 5 has been such a quiet console generation thus far. The biggest successes for PlayStation since the PS5 released have been games like Marvel’s Spider-Man 2, Ghost of Yōtei, Astro Bot, Death Stranding 2: On the Beach, God of War Ragnarök, and Saros. One of those six was from a third-party studio, and four of them are from studios that, as far as we know, haven’t been bogged down by trying to create a live-service title for Sony. Meanwhile, other studios that have put out successful games for Sony in the past have found themselves completely stalled by live-service development that went nowhere. This includes:

  • Bend Studio (Days Gone) - was working on a now canceled live-service game and subsequently had 30% of its staff laid off.

  • Geurrilla Games (Horizon) - is actively working on the aforementioned Horizon Hunters Gathering that is at risk of being canceled if they can’t hit a milestone by December after having to remove all of the game’s live-service systems due to player feedback.

  • Naughty Dog (The Last of Us, Uncharted) - hasn’t released a new game this console generation despite it being almost five years old, largely due to them spending several years and hundreds of millions of dollars to develop a now canceled The Last of Us live-service game.

  • Bluepoint Games (Demon’s Souls Remake, Shadow of the Colossus Remake) - despite tons of experience remastering and remaking PlayStation titles to great success, was tasked with developing a God of War live-service game that eventually got canceled and led to the studio being shut down in 2026.

  • London Studio - PlayStation’s internal VR team that was releasing at least a new game every year, on average, was suddenly tasked with developing a multiplayer game playable outside of VR and was shut down in May 2024 after going about five years not releasing any titles.

And this list doesn’t even mention studios that hadn’t produced a game yet or released less-than-impressive games in their history, only to be waylaid or canned by PlayStation after working on a live-service. The most notable of these examples is of course Firewalk Studios with their game Concord.

It’s hard to imagine just how big of a hold PlayStation would have on the industry and just how successful its internal development teams would be right now if PlayStation didn’t put so many of its chips on the live-service model.

The Video Game Industry Is Shifting

Okay. This is pretty much always true. However, I think in the past 5-10 years, there’s been a dramatic shift that affects all facets of the industry, and that’s what Bain & Company refers to as “the average player.” Bain & Co. released findings from their 2026 Gaming Report this past week, and it focuses heavily on how the industry is so saturated that it’s sort of creating separate genre bubbles of the market to a degree that hasn’t been seen before.

Not long ago, the games industry was less digital and had far fewer games released every year. For reference, let’s look at Steam. In 2021, 11,217 Steam games were released. In 2025, just four years later, that number nearly doubled to 21,336. 2025’s numbers are also more than 7.5 times the number of games released a decade prior in 2015.

The other component of this that we can largely thank digital gaming for is the growth of the back catalogue. As more and more games release every year, the games that released in previous years don’t go away. I personally am very familiar with this. As of writing this post, I’ve managed to complete 24 games so far in 2026. Of those, only seven released this year. And this is a good year for me! In any given year, I usually only play three or four games that released that same year. There are so many good games from the past that I never got around to playing that are being sold at very reasonable prices.

This type of growth leads to an industry in which, according to Bain & Co., “The game shelf has become effectively infinite, and choices are multiplying faster than any player’s attention can grow.” So when Bain & Co. talk about the average gamer no longer existing, they’re talking about the new world we live in, in which game companies can no longer seek to serve large sections of the gaming population. While some games exist that can manage to capture that type of audience, targeting it is actually far too risky. Another common way of putting it is the age-old wisdom that if you try to make a game for everybody, you end up making it for nobody.

Since gamers don’t have to make do with whatever game genres happen to be serviced in a particular year, they can feel free to live within a specific niche of the industry that they really love, rarely venturing out to other genres or themes. This is why defining your target audience is so important. If you have a particular subset of the gaming market in mind, you can market to and service that market much better than trying to satisfy everybody. This gives developers freedom to experiment within their genre and avoid creating watered down features that don’t appeal to anyone.

The importance of catering to a particular audience becomes more apparent when looking at the results for play time and spending amongst gamers. The survey suggests that nearly 60% of total game hours played come from the those in the top 20% in terms of play time. Furthermore, 73% of video game spending comes from the top 20% of spenders. In other words, when you’re able to find your niche and cater heavily to the top 20% most engaged players within that niche, you’re bound for success.

What’s interesting is that this is largely how the world of books works. While I’m certainly not an expert in it, most authors have to spend the time finding and catering to a particular niche, and these niches get very specific. We’re not just talking fantasy; we’re not just talking high fantasy; we’re talking authors who specialize in cozy high fantasy specifically with dragons where the main character always dies. Okay, that’s probably a bit of an exaggeration, but it’s not too far off. And it has to be that way because the audience for books and the books themselves are too vast and varied to try to cater to everybody.

And this isn’t just speculation. This is backed up by further data in Bain & Co.’s surveys. When asked what their interests in new video games were in the next year, about two-thirds of gamers said they were most interested in the games they already play (13%), games that are similar (33%), or franchise sequels (19%).

Now, I will say, I don’t fully agree with the findings by Bain & Co. I believe their analysis of some of the data is a bit flawed with hasty recommendations to game company executives.

For one, I think the survey fails to capture the reason many games do so well. While it’s not a safe bet to appeal to too large of an audience, it’s important to acknowledge that the best-selling and sometimes the best-reviewed games are the ones that cater to a particular audience but provide a friendly introduction to a genre for the uninitiated. I believe this was one of the strengths of Clair Obscur: Expedition 33. I’m not much of a JRPG or turn-based combat fan; I’ve only connected with a few of them. Clair Obscur was one of them. The game’s focus on more simple RPG mechanics, characters with far less complexity than others in combat, and narrative served to appeal to fans of the genre while inviting others in to experience the fun without making them feel alienated. In this way, you do want to aim for a generic audience. However, you’re not aiming you whole game; you’re aiming aspects of the experience so that you leave the door open to the rest of the world.

All of the top 10 best-selling games of all time have something about them that makes them easy to get into for just about any person, even if they don’t fall in love with it or play for very long. Games like Tetris, Minecraft, Wii Sports, and Super Mario Bros. hang their hats on simplicity, making themselves approachable for any gamer. Red Dead Redemption 2, The Elder Scrolls V: Skyrim, and The Witcher 3: Wild Hunt embrace compelling narratives and worlds to draw players in who otherwise wouldn’t be interested in the genre. Mario Kart 8, Terraria, PlayerUnkown’s Battlegrounds, and Human: Fall Flat embrace multiplayer as a way to give players a way to interact with their friends. And Grand Theft Auto V… is Grand Theft Auto V.

I also don’t particularly see Bain & Co.’s leap in logic in regards to AI. They asked gamers a simple question: “Thinking broadly, how has your overall comfort with games using AI changed over the past 12 months?” To be fair, the results surprised me. 42% of respondents said that their comfortability with companies using AI has increased either “somewhat” or “significantly.” Another 44% said it stayed the same. With this data, it’s easy to reach the conclusion that Bain & Co. did, which is that “For studios worried that AI adoption carries reputational risk with their player base, this data suggests the window to move is open…”

However, even if other data were to show that this is true, this is a faulty conclusion based on the data collected by Bain & Co. 42% of respondents said that their comfortability with AI increased… increased from what to what? It would’ve been far more valuable to demonstrate this by asking respondents for ratings 0-10 indicating their current comfortability to go along with this. What if the majority of people who said that their comfortability increased gave a comfortability score of less than four? How significantly were those increases, then? It’s the classic fallacy that people fall into when they hear something like “eating xyz food every day doubles your changes of getting such-and-such disease.” That’s scary! I’m never eating xyz food again! Meanwhile, what they don’t tell you is that it increases your changes from 0.25% to 0.5%. If you love xyz food, maybe that’s not enough to stop you from eating it every other day or once a week.

Bain & Co. falls into this fallacy hook, line, and sinker, stating that executives should “Rebuild the focused portfolio on an AI-reset cost base. This is a top-down, organization-wide capability deployment, not simply handing API keys to individual developers and calling it good.“ I think this is a huge mistake. “Top-down, organization-wide capability deployment” is what we’re already seeing. Large companies are several years into doing this, and as someone who works at a large company, it’s painful. Executives fisting AI down their employees throats is what this is advocating for, and I think it’s a short-sighted waste of time and resources.

The reality is that employees will accept just about anything that makes their lives or jobs easier. If there’s an AI that will do that for them, they will find it and use it. Restructuring your entire organization on AI for efficiency and speed actually stands to slow your teams down because they’re forced to do so in order to find a way to incorporate this company-mandated piece of technology into their workflow even though it isn’t helpful. To be fair, that’s more of a hypothesis than a data-driven argument. However, I think it holds as much water as Bain & Co.’s analyses do as they relate to AI.

I think it’s worth noting that Bain & Company has a lot of metaphorical (and possibly literal) stock in AI. In their “About Us” overview, it appears three times in three paragraphs, including the statement: “We’ve led large-scale transformations through every technology wave, and today technology and AI are in everything we do.“ It’s also right there in the first sentence of their “What We Do” page and second sentence of their “What We Believe” page. Needless to say, they have a vested interest in companies using AI, so it makes sense that they would include in their study any kind of reasoning they can that companies should use AI.

Finally, I’ll also note that I don’t like that it’s been very difficult for me to find any information about where their data is coming from. I don’t personally like when these surveys don’t come with descriptions of the sample they surveyed, how that sample was acquired, etc. Even though this likely isn’t often the case, it makes it feel like the data was done in bad faith. For example, Bain & Co. couldn’t even be bothered to tell us how they went about gathering data for their 100 games released in 2023. What was the criteria? Was it random? What were these 100 games? That should be an easy one to include in the report. It doesn’t require any statistical or technical jargon.

Anyway, I don’t take this survey quite that seriously given their practices, but I do think there are some important truths gleamed in it.

More GTA VI Leaks

CYBERLEEK, a vigilante hacker group, has leaked gameplay footage of Grand Theft Auto VI, the second time this has happened in the last four years. The first time it happened, the teenager responsible was hunted down and incarcerated. This time is a lot more serious, though. This isn’t a matter of leaked gameplay footage of a very early build. This is leaked footage of a very final-looking build as well as a threat to release the build that’s been acquired to millions. The build does appear to be genuine. Some footage reportedly shows Jason Duval, one of the game’s main characters, spraying bullets into a wall to spell out “LEEK,” something that is mighty impressive to pull off if CYBERLEEK does not in fact have a working build.

Another component of this is the financial aspect by way of a crypto meme coin. CYBERLEEK has watermarked all of the footage with the name of their meme coin with the promise that the hacking group intends to use the proceeds from it to do something unannounced for the gaming community. I think this one aspect of the leaks shows that Rockstar is dealing with more young and stupid people looking to make a quick buck off of scamming others.

If the financial gain is not the group’s main goal, it claims to focus on targeting game publishers that don’t adhere to specific core tenants. I haven’t read these tenants myself in an effort to not give CYBERLEEK the additional traffic nor spoil any aspect of GTA VI for myself, but I imagine they’re largely consumer-based tenants painting the group as a modern Robin Hood for gamers.

Jason Schreier had some interesting points from talking to employees at Rockstar about these leaks. After the first leaks, Rockstar called all employees back to work for five days a week, ending any remote/hybrid work opportunities at the company. Employees obviously didn’t take this well. This was in an effort to reduce the potential for leaks going forward by keeping all work related to GTA VI inaccessible from outside of Rockstar buildings.

With more leaks anyway, though, employees feel understandably crushed. Not only is it heavily disappointing seeing your work plastered on the internet in less-than-ideal circumstances and with a meme coin watermark all over it, but it just serves as evidence that the dismantling of their remote work flexibility was all for naught. I would imagine they’re unlikely to get that privilege back after this either.

If you couldn’t tell, I’m not a fan of this game leaking nonsense. I don’t think it actually does anything to the company long-term. If you look back at The Last of Us Part II’s leaks, they created controversy, but ultimately, it just gave a bigger platform for Naughty Dog and the game. They would spring off of that platform into many Game of the Year awards, including at The Game Awards in 2020. All it does is cause problems and make it more difficult for fans to get their hands on the game they’ve been waiting so patiently for.

Insight Into How Game Trailers Appear at Gamescom

Gamescom’s Opening Night Live event, with none other than Geoff Keighley as the host, has had tons of amazing trailers for already-announced games and games that are being seen for the first time. More information came to light about the process of getting games on Opening Night Live, an opportunity any studio would excitedly jump at given it worked within their marketing plan. Last year, such an opportunity seemed well out of reach when reports suggested that the cost to have a 60-second trailer in ONL rang in at around $119,000. Many smaller games get released on budgets lower than that.

Last August, reports surfaced to the contrary, claiming that it was actually free to have your game’s trailer in the show as long as Keighley liked what he saw.

Naturally, the truth appears to lay somewhere in the middle. According to Keighley earlier this week, there are paid placements and “editorial” placements at ONL: paid placements are essentially advertisements, the time for which the publishers have paid for, and editorial placements are freely given to games that Keighley and some others involved with ONL feel deserve the spot in the show to support the developers.

To me, this sounds very consistent with Keighley’s methodology. I’ve heard several reports on what it takes to get a spot at The Game Awards for your trailer, another event hosted and run by Keighley. It also happens to be one of my favorite gaming events of the year. Depending on the spot in the show that your trailer goes in, a 60-second trailer is estimated to cost up to $450,000. However, smaller developers have told stories of Keighley and his team reaching out to them to ask if they wanted a spot in the show free of charge. Following the Highguard disaster at the 2025 Game Awards show where Highguard was tremendously hyped up by Keighley and showed as the final trailer of the night, the developers, Wildlight Entertainment, revealed that they did not ask for that spot in the show. Instead, Keighley liked it so much that he decided to put it as the final announcement. I’m not sure if Wildlight initially paid to be in the show but then got a higher profile spot or if it was one of those games that got a free ride. Nonetheless, it supports the idea that Keighley and his teams don’t simply chase the money when it comes to trailer placement in events.
